You really need to figure costs.  Fruitcake, if done well(or why do it)  uses expensive ingredients, requires attention weekly with good brandy or spirits, and takes a lot of time.  A thumbnail sketch has these starting at about $30 a pound.  That is about half the size of an 8" loaf.  You might be able to shave some costs on a larger cake.

 

Really nail down your costs or you will lose your shirt here.
